The Psychology of Risk-Taking

The “chicken road” game isn’t just about mathematics; it also taps into fundamental psychological principles. The escalating reward structure activates the brain’s reward system, creating a compelling loop that encourages players to continue. This is exacerbated by the ‘near miss’ effect, where almost hitting an obstacle feels like a partial win, reinforcing the desire to take another risk. Cognitive biases, such as the gambler’s fallacy (believing that a string of losses increases the chance of a win), can also influence decision-making and lead to impulsive choices.

  • Impulse Control: A key factor in avoiding exorbitant losses.
  • Reward System Activation: The core driver of continued play.
  • Cognitive Biases: Leading to irrational decision-making.

Recognizing these psychological factors and mitigating their influence is paramount to successful play. Players must adopt a disciplined strategy and refrain from chasing losses, instead adhering to pre-determined exit points.

The Power of Tiered Cash-Outs

Tiered cash-outs introduce an element of risk management by allowing players to secure profits at multiple points throughout the game. For example, a player might cash out 25% of their winnings at a multiplier of 2x, another 25% at 3x, and the remaining 50% at 4x. This strategy guarantees a return on investment, even if the chicken encounters an obstacle before reaching a higher multiplier. The logic behind this is that multiple smaller wins are better than one large loss.

Managing Bankroll and Staying Disciplined

Effective bankroll management is crucial for long-term success in any game of chance. Players should only wager amounts they can afford to lose and avoid chasing losses in an attempt to recoup funds. A common guideline is to allocate only a small percentage of one’s overall bankroll to each session, further mitigating the risk of significant financial setbacks. Maintaining discipline and sticking to a pre-defined strategy are also essential. The thrill of the game can easily lead to impulsive decisions, so having a clear and rational plan in place is vital.

  1. Define a Session Bankroll: Limit the amount of money used per play session.
  2. Set Daily/Weekly Limits: Establish boundaries to prevent overspending.
  3. Avoid Chasing Losses: Don’t attempt to recover lost funds by increasing stakes.

Remembering the fundamental principles of responsible gaming and not allowing emotions to cloud judgment are essential for a positive and sustainable experience.
